#1914f1 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1914f1 is composed of 9.8% red, 7.8% green and 94.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89.6% cyan, 91.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 241.4 degrees, a saturation of 88.8% and a lightness of 51.2%. #1914f1 color hex could be obtained by blending #3228ff with #0000e3. Closest websafe color is: #0000ff.

Shades and Tints of #1914f1

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000006 is the darkest color, while #f2f2f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1914f1

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7e7d88 is the less saturated color, while #100afb is the most saturated one.
